The Development of Online Betting
The journey of internet betting began in the middle of the 1990s, a time when the web was still in its early stages. สล็อต168 The first virtual casinos emerged , allowing players to enjoy in their favorite activities from the comfort of their houses. Pioneering platforms offered limited choices, yet they sparked considerable curiosity and opened the door for a new era in the gambling industry . With the advent of secure payment methods and enhanced internet speeds , digital gambling reignited a wave of excitement among players looking for ease.
As technology progressed, so did the offerings of internet betting platforms. By the start of the 2000s, companies began to launch live dealer games and a wider range of sports betting options . The improved visuals and engaging elements made virtual casinos more appealing to players , while mobile optimization began to take form, allowing bettors to gamble on the go . This period also saw the rise of internet poker, which gained immense fame and resulted in significant competitions that drew participants from around the globe .
In recent times, the arena of internet betting has changed dramatically with the advent of applications and live streaming technologies . The ease of placing bets with a few taps on a smartphone has attracted a fresh group, while legal adjustments in different areas have contributed to the expansion of the industry. Furthermore, the inclusion of cryptocurrencies has offered bettors additional options in how they manage their funds . As the industry continues to change, internet betting is set to become even more engaging and available, promising exciting developments for both players and businesses alike.

Obstacles and Policies
The surge of online gambling has brought with it a series of challenges, particularly in the area of regulation. Regulatory bodies across the world are dealing with how to successfully regulate online betting platforms. The swiftly evolving nature of technology means that regulatory frameworks often struggle behind, creating a mishmash of laws that vary significantly from one jurisdiction to another. This variation can confuse consumers and makes it challenging for operators to comply fully, leading to potential legal issues.
Another significant concern is the safeguarding of vulnerable populations. With the ease of access of online betting, there is an increased risk of gambling addiction, particularly among young people. Regulators face the challenging task of implementing measures that balance consumer protection with the interests of the gambling industry. Developing strong responsible gambling programs and ensuring that operators adhere to strict guidelines is crucial in addressing these issues.
Finally, the implementation of regulations poses its own challenges. Many online gambling sites are based in international jurisdictions, making it challenging for national authorities to enforce local laws. This often results in issues such as financial crimes and fraud, which can undermine the integrity of the gaming industry. As online betting continues to increase, partnership between countries will be essential to create a unified approach to regulation and enforcement, ensuring a protected environment for all participants.
